I have been making a couple of cards with the freebie stamps from Craft Stamper. This one uses the flower from the latest issue, cut out and mounted on a background stamped with the Prima Notary stamp. This is brilliant value for a script background sized 4" x 6". I coloured the images with Sunshine Yellow Adirondack dye ink, Spiced Marmalade DI and Cranberry Adirondack. I added a little heart button and some orange sparkles. The whole card is tiny, only just over 2" square.
